Teams’ Last Battle Saw 2-0 Killie Victory

St Mirren played out a 2-2 draw in their last game. This was away from home at Fir Park against Motherwell. Stephen Robinson's team enjoyed just 39% possession and had four shots on target, while Caolan Boyd-Munce and Killian Phillips scored one goal apiece.

Kilmarnock played Hibernian at home in their previous game. It was a 1-1 draw at Rugby Park. Killie had 49% possession and recorded four shots on goal, with Fraser Murray on the scoresheet.

Kilmarnock have not lost to St Mirren in the past ten meetings. In their last clash, hosts Kilmarnock came out with a 2-0 victory at Rugby Park. The past 10 H2H matches have included five Kilmarnock wins along with five draws.

St Mirren – Last 10 League Games

2 wins, 6 losses and 2 draws, averaging 1.0 goals from 6.8 attempts and 3.8 shots on goal. St Mirren have had 39.8% possession and 4.3 corners per match. On average, they have conceded 1.7 goals from 9.1 attempts and 5.0 shots on goal, while their opponents have earned 4.9 corners.

Top goalscorer Mikael Mandron has found the net 4 times, with Killian Phillips and Toyosi Olusanya scoring 2 each. Toyosi Olusanya is the leading assists maker with 2.

Kilmarnock – Last 10 League Games

Killie have won 3, lost 5 and drawn 2, with an average of 1.1 goals from 9.7 attempts and 4.4 shots on goal. There’s been an average of 48.8% possession, 6.4 corners in their favour and 4.3 corners against, while they’ve conceded 1.2 goals from 8.4 attempts and 3.1 shots on goal.

Fraser Murray is top scorer on 3, with Bobby Wales and Bruce Anderson next on 2. Joe Wright, Fraser Murray and Bobby Wales have been the top assists providers with 1 in the previous 10 games.
